[QUOTE="wwb, post: 127985, member: 15747"] I have an 843 and there was an oil leak at the rear of the motor and it was spraying oil into the radiator. It would run hot quite often especially on a hot day and working hard. When I cleaned the rad with a pressure washer it was much better. I eventually pulled the motor and fixed the leak, and it has been great since. I would suggest to check the radiator to make sure it is clean. [/QUOTE]
